Output 42a266c6952c7cbf9864fe8d391922eebdbef716597a3a3e8125d1458ac20465:137

value
39911936
script pubkey
OP_0 OP_PUSHBYTES_20 c008fdbd83a53d9ab13a575d3aa9043570339bd3
address
bc1qcqy0m0vr557e4vf62awn42gyx4cr8x7nxxcsky
transaction
42a266c6952c7cbf9864fe8d391922eebdbef716597a3a3e8125d1458ac20465